Responsibilities:
  • Focus on safe work practices and high quality while executing duties with a sense of urgency
  • Adhere to all required safety requirements, company policies, and procedures
  • Move trailers in and out of the dock in a timely manner
  • Inspect trailers and loads in the yard and on the dock as needed
  • Ensure accurate and timely loading and unloading of tractor-trailers per pick ticket requirements
  • Troubleshoot equipment problems, follow preventative maintenance procedures, and make basic repairs and document adjustments
  • Prepare and continuously document all reporting requirements accurately and a timely manner
  • Interact with warehouse team members, production, and quality control to maximize output efficiency, quality, and safety
  • Work with peers and teammates to achieve departmental and plant goals
  • Follow plant standards to execute the recycling program which includes the operation of a grinder and baler
  • Operate a forklift to perform shipping / receiving activities in a fast-paced environment
  • Utilize various desktop systems to prioritize and organize workload
  • Work independently and as a team to accomplish daily tasks
  • Dock coordination and loading / shipping duties as needed
Qualifications:
  • High School Diploma, GED, or equivalent work experience
  • Valid Class A Commercial Driver's License (for applicable CDL positions)
  • 1 or more years of experience driving a yard truck is preferred
  • Ability to lift and move objects up to 50 lbs. with or without a reasonable accommodation
  • Experience with warehouse inventory scanners and basic maintenance equipment is preferred
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ft applications and SAP experience is a plus
  • Prior forklift or heavy equipment experience in a manufacturing environment is preferred
  • Ability to sit for long periods of time and drive backwards as needed
  • You must have the ability to obtain a DOT medical card for the purpose of working for Primo Brands (for applicable CDL positions)
  • You must possess a clean driving record, which means: in the last 3 years that you’ve only had 1 license, no driving-related suspensions, revocations, or cancellations, no disqualifying offenses, no more than 2 moving violations and no reckless driving incidents and in the last 3 years, no major driving offenses including DUI/DWI, refusal to test, leaving the scene, driving a commercial vehicle without a CDL, or at-fault fatal accident
  • Must be 21 years of age or older (for applicable CDL positions)
